John J. Eagan, the Managing Partner of the firm, has dedicated his practice to the area of taxation, with emphasis on business, international, tax litigation and health care matters.
John regularly provides general business tax counseling and planning on a variety of issues including mergers and acquisitions, corporate reorganizations, partnership and LLC taxation, and international transactions. Additionally, John advises clients on a full range of issues related to exempt organizations.
John has represented clients before state taxing authorities, the Internal Revenue Service, and U.S. Tax Court with regard to civil tax litigation, including corporate tax assessments, foreign taxation and treaty interpretation, sales and use taxation, state income tax allocation and apportionment issues, partnership allocations, and excise taxation.
In the area of health care, John has particular expertise on the tax aspects of intermediate sanctions, health care organization restructuring, virtual mergers involving joint operating companies, and joint ventures.
